Things to Keep in Mind for RBI Grade B 2023 Preparation

  1. This exam can be cracked in the first attempt itself. So, if you devised a strategy for 2-3 years you must embrace changes and build a new strategy.
  2. Mock tests are the most important part of the preparation, take them seriously.
  3. Remember this mantra that less is more. Do not get misguided by people who are always buying different sources for a single topic. Stick to your source, thoroughly.
  4. Be confident and believe in your strategy. Do planning for each step.
  5. Attempt your mocks in a disciplined environment like in the exam. Give your mock tests regularly and assess your performance.

RBI Grade B Exam Pattern

One of the largest exams conducted in the banking sector, the RBI exam pattern for the Grade B Officer post has not changed in the past few years.  The recruitment of RBI Grade-B officers takes place in the following stages:

  • RBI Grade B Phase 1 (Prelims) (Objective type)
  • RBI Grade B Phase 2 (Mains) 
  • Interview

RBI Grade B Phase 1 Exam Pattern

As per the RBI exam pattern, the RBI Grade B Prelims exam consists of four sections in total. It is objective. A detailed breakdown of the RBI exam pattern is given below:-

RBI Grade-B Prelims Exam Pattern

Name of Paper

No. of Questions

Number of Marks

Time Duration

General Awareness

80

80

25 Minutes

English Language

30

30

25 Minutes

Quantitative Aptitude

30

30

25 Minutes

Reasoning Ability

60

60

45 Minutes

Total

200

200

120 Minutes

RBI Grade B Phase 2 Exam Pattern

Let us now check the exam pattern for the next phase. In this, you've to score good marks to be able to achieve a rank in the exam.

RBI Grade B Mains Exam Pattern

Name of the Paper

Type of Paper

Number of Marks

Time Duration

Paper 1 Economic & Social Issues

Objective+ Descriptive

100

120 minutes

Paper 2 English (Writing Skills)

Descriptive Type

100

90 minutes

Paper 3 Finance & Management

Objective+ Descriptive

100

120 minutes

How to Build a Disciplined Study Plan?

  1. Pick up two different subjects on a day to avoid boredom.
  2. Allot alternate timings to the subjects to maintain consistency.
  3. Always go through the syllabus and solve previous years' papers.
  4. For relaxing purposes, listen to your favorite music and talk to your closest friends.
  5. Decide on what time, you want to wake up and when to sleep. This will help you in building a powerful routine.

Before the RBI Grade B Phase 1 Exam:

  • Start with the preparation of General Awareness. Do not wait for the prelims result. Develop a habit of reading newspapers regularly.
  • Prepare well Quantitative Aptitude, English, and Reasoning sections.
  • Practice high-scoring topics like English words, quadratic equations, simplification, series questions, syllogism, direction-sense, alphanumeric series, reading comprehension, fill-in-the-blanks, etc. These are a few basic topics that you must practice vigorously because they will lead to higher scoring.
  • Practice sectional tests regularly and analyze your preparation.

 After the RBI Grade B Phase 1 Exam:

  • Start with Paper 1 of Economics and Social Issues as it contains both objective and subjective based questions. This pattern is also similar to paper 3 of Finance and Management.
  • Practice full-length mocks and assess your preparation level. Use online sources like Byjus Exam Prep.
  • Prepare current affairs(CA) including banking-related CA of the past 6 months from the day of the exam.

 After the RBI Grade B Phase 2:

  • After your main exam gets over, start preparing for the interview round.
  • Look at the interviews available on Youtube channels.
  • Be aware of all the happenings around you, read newspapers, and prepare yourself with different questions.
  • Have a thorough knowledge of the place of birth and local state information. Local folk dances and architecture.
  • Try to develop your views, practice, and revise them in front of the mirror. Build your confidence and self-esteem.
